|
Share-Based Compensation - Schedule of Non Vested Share Option Activity (Details) - $ / shares
|6 Months Ended
|
Jun. 30, 2025
|
Jun. 30, 2024
|Share Option [Member]
|Schedule of Non Vested Share Option Activity [Line Items]
|Non-vested Beginning
|6,808,475
|9,700,553
|Weighted Average Grant-Date Fair Value, Beginning
|$ 5.21
|$ 4.19
|Non-vested, Granted
|805,889
|3,539,627
|Weighted Average Grant-Date Fair Value, Granted
|$ 9.49
|$ 6.55
|Non-vested, Vested
|(1,914,905)
|(2,779,542)
|Weighted Average Grant-Date Fair Value, Vested
|$ 3.68
|$ 3.81
|Non-vested, Exercised
|(148,434)
|Weighted Average Grant-Date Fair Value, Exercised
|$ 4.41
|Non-vested, Cancelled/forfeited
|(124,823)
|(397,909)
|Weighted Average Grant-Date Fair Value, Cancelled/forfeited
|$ 5.61
|$ 4.66
|Non-vested Ending
|5,574,636
|9,914,295
|Weighted Average Grant-Date Fair Value, Ending
|$ 6.35
|$ 5.11
|Restricted Share Unit [Member]
|Schedule of Non Vested Share Option Activity [Line Items]
|Non-vested Beginning
|4,211,661
|3,668,839
|Weighted Average Grant-Date Fair Value, Beginning
|$ 5.97
|$ 4.86
|Non-vested, Granted
|648,510
|2,711,130
|Weighted Average Grant-Date Fair Value, Granted
|$ 9.55
|$ 6.72
|Non-vested, Vested
|(473,761)
|(941,877)
|Weighted Average Grant-Date Fair Value, Vested
|$ 5.07
|$ 5.21
|Non-vested, Cancelled/forfeited
|(70,965)
|(38,891)
|Weighted Average Grant-Date Fair Value, Cancelled/forfeited
|$ 6.13
|$ 6.01
|Non-vested Ending
|4,315,445
|5,399,201
|Weighted Average Grant-Date Fair Value, Ending
|$ 6.6
|$ 5.69
|Restricted Share Award [Member]
|Schedule of Non Vested Share Option Activity [Line Items]
|Non-vested Beginning
|1,295,450
|2,590,904
|Weighted Average Grant-Date Fair Value, Beginning
|$ 2.85
|$ 2.85
|Non-vested, Granted
|2,401,884
|496,219
|Weighted Average Grant-Date Fair Value, Granted
|$ 9.61
|$ 6.66
|Non-vested, Vested
|(3,697,334)
|(1,791,669)
|Weighted Average Grant-Date Fair Value, Vested
|$ 7.24
|$ 3.91
|Non-vested, Cancelled/forfeited
|Weighted Average Grant-Date Fair Value, Cancelled/forfeited
|Non-vested Ending
|1,295,454
|Weighted Average Grant-Date Fair Value, Ending
|$ 2.85
|X
- Definition
+ References
Number of non-vested options exercised.
+ Details
No definition available.
|X
- Definition
+ References
Weighted average grant-date fair value of non-vested options exercised.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Gross number of share options (or share units) granted during the period.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The weighted average grant-date fair value of options granted during the reporting period as calculated by applying the disclosed option pricing methodology.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Number of non-vested options outstanding.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Number of non-vested options forfeited.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Weighted average grant-date fair value of non-vested options forfeited.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Weighted average grant-date fair value of non-vested options outstanding.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Number of options vested.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Weighted average grant-date fair value of options vested.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Details
|X
- Details
|X
- Details